Bitcoin Whale Realizes $9.47M Profit After Closing $209M Short Position

On June 19, on-chain analyst Ai Yi reported that a prominent Bitcoin whale, identified as @Jason60704294 or "Set 10 Big Goals," successfully closed a massive short position. The trader liquidated a 3,173.6 BTC short position valued at approximately $209 million, which was initially opened at an average price of $65,907.13. By exiting at $62,916.04, the whale realized a profit of roughly $9.467 million. This transaction marks the whale's third trade in June, bringing their total monthly profit to $12.85 million with a 66.7% win rate. Following a brief one-hour hiatus, the account shifted to a bullish stance, opening a new long position of 999.121 BTC worth $62.62 million at an entry price of $62,682.
